    The Science Behind Cationic Surfactants

    Cationic surfactants are amphiphilic molecules, meaning they have both hydrophobic (water-repelling) and hydrophilic (water-attracting) parts. This unique structure allows them to interact with both water and non-polar substances, making them effective in a variety of applications. They can form micelles, which are spherical structures that trap non-polar molecules, allowing them to be easily removed from the surface. They can also form bilayers, which are flat structures that can be used to deliver drugs or other substances through the skin.*

    Types of Cationic Surfactants

    Cationic surfactants are classified into several types based on their chemical structure and properties. Some of the most common types of cationic surfactants include:

  • Quaternary ammonium compounds (quats): These are the most common type of cationic surfactant and are widely used in personal care products. Quats are formed by the reaction of an alkylamine with an alkyl halide. Alkylpyridinium compounds: These are also known as pyridinium salts and are used in various industrial applications, including the manufacture of detergents and cleaning products.

    The Need for Safer Cationic Surfactants

    Cationic surfactants have been widely used in various applications, including personal care products, cleaning agents, and pharmaceuticals. However, their use has been linked to environmental and health concerns, such as:

  • Toxicity to aquatic life: Cationic surfactants can be toxic to aquatic organisms, causing harm to fish and other aquatic species. Bioaccumulation: Cationic surfactants can accumulate in the environment and in living organisms, potentially leading to long-term health effects. Environmental persistence: Cationic surfactants can persist in the environment for extended periods, contributing to pollution and ecosystem disruption. ## The Development of Safer Cationic Surfactants**
